Piko 52630 diesel locomotive BR 102.1, DR, Ep. IV Product Details
As an Expert model, the new shape of the PIKO 102.1 was given a motor with a precisely balanced flywheel. The automatic white/red light change depending on the direction of travel is combined with the ability to switch off the red "tail light" separately. "tail light" can be switched off separately. The cab lighting allows prototypical night operation. The model is equipped with a PluX22 interface for digital operation. Free-standing grab irons and and metal railings produced using an elaborate etching technique complete the sophisticated appearance of the PIKO model.

Frequently asked questions
| Question: | Which model railway layouts is the PIKO 52630 diesel locomotive suitable for? |
| Answer: | The model is designed for H0 layouts using a two-rail DC system. It represents a Deutsche Reichsbahn Class 102.1 diesel locomotive from Era IV and is particularly suitable for shunting duties and short transfer or freight trains. |
| Question: | Is the locomotive supplied with a digital decoder? |
| Answer: | No, the model is supplied in analogue form. However, a digital interface allows a compatible decoder to be installed later. |
| Question: | Which lighting functions does the model provide? |
| Answer: | The locomotive features direction-dependent lighting. The leading end is therefore illuminated according to the direction of travel. |
| Question: | Which types of operation suit the Class 102.1? |
| Answer: | The compact shunting locomotive is particularly suitable for stations, sidings, freight facilities and industrial areas. It can move individual wagons, small wagon groups and short transfer trains. |
